Pain and ecstasy are one and the same in Clive Barker's Hellraiser: Revival. This first-person crawl through the darkest depths of torment has just been selected as number 17 in the list of the PC Gaming Show: Most Wanted's 25 most anticipated upcoming games, and the studio has taken to the screen to show its appreciation.
Wishlist Clive Barker's Hellraiser: Revival now on Steam
In an interview aired along with cinematic and dev diary footage during the show, game director Emil Esov and narrative director Antony De Fault spoke about their upcoming game: "a discomforting and dark story," according to Esov.
This singleplayer horror spectacle doesn't shun the taboo indulgences of sadism and masochism, but instead embraces them in their most brutal and visceral form.
